What You're Really Paying For in a 120Ah Battery

Let's dissect a typical $950 lithium battery:

  • Active materials (cathode/anode): $310
  • Battery Management System: $180
  • Manufacturing labor: $75
  • Testing/certification: $55
  • Transportation: $35
  • Profit margin: $295

Battery Type Cycle Life Total Cost/10k Wh
Lead-Acid 1,200 cycles $8.90
Standard Li-ion 3,500 cycles $4.20
Highjoule HJT-120S 6,800 cycles $2.15
